Output abd7bdcc6517a85bbde7374ebdc55eca08556353272e436f42dafb755fbd484a:20

value
2941115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fba643682421083dc1811ff007b6e64a46e2d81 OP_EQUAL
address
338BM8JMbofsq3oi1Hxb2G1R65P53fmPMD
transaction
abd7bdcc6517a85bbde7374ebdc55eca08556353272e436f42dafb755fbd484a
confirmations
244506
spent
true